Saveez Saffarian is a scholar working on Molecular Biology, Virology and Cell Biology. According to data from OpenAlex, Saveez Saffarian has authored 38 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 10 papers in Virology and 10 papers in Cell Biology. Recurrent topics in Saveez Saffarian's work include Lipid Membrane Structure and Behavior (11 papers), HIV Research and Treatment (9 papers) and Cellular transport and secretion (9 papers). Saveez Saffarian is often cited by papers focused on Lipid Membrane Structure and Behavior (11 papers), HIV Research and Treatment (9 papers) and Cellular transport and secretion (9 papers). Saveez Saffarian collaborates with scholars based in United States, India and Israel. Saveez Saffarian's co-authors include Tomas Kirchhausen, Elliot L. Elson, Ramiro Massol, Emanuele Cocucci, David K. Cureton, Sean P. J. Whelan, Emmanuel Boucrot, Ivan E. Collier, Krishnananda Chattopadhyay and Carl Frieden and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and PLoS ONE.
